What is an Angle Grinder?
An angle grinder is a portable power tool that uses a turning disc to grind, cut, or polish various products. The term "angle" describes the orientation of the tool which permits it to grind at different angles. These mills can be powered by electricity, batteries, or compressed air and are available in numerous sizes, with the 125mm size being the most in-demand for both light domestic use and sturdy applications.

One of the most engaging features of angle mills with speed control is the ability to change the RPM (Revolutions Per Minute) of the turning disc. This is especially beneficial when working with various products. For instance, slower speeds are ideal for polishing, while higher speeds are much better for cutting through metal.
Improved Safety
Speed control also translates into better safety. Over-revving an angle grinder can result in increased threats of injury or damage to materials. With speed control, operators can use the tool according to the demands of the specific job, decreasing mishaps.
Quality Results
Attaining quality results is frequently linked to the variety of transformations per minute a tool can make. The ability to tailor this feature permits users to achieve finer surfaces, more accurate cuts, and greater general output.

A1: The main difference depends on the disc size. A 125mm angle grinder is smaller sized and more suited for detailed work, while a 150mm grinder can handle larger tasks and more significant products.
Q2: Is speed control necessary on an angle grinder?
A2: While not strictly necessary, speed control provides much better versatility, security, and accuracy, making it an important function for many users.
Q3: Can I utilize any kind of disc with a speed-controlled angle grinder?
A3: Always ensure the disc works with your specific angle grinder. Consult the user handbook for suggested disc sizes and types.
Q4: How do I understand when to replace the discs?
A4: Discs need to be changed when they reveal signs of excessive wear, splitting, or when they have ended up being too thin to use securely.
